The duration hair conditioner remains applied is a crucial factor determining its efficacy. This application time influences the degree to which conditioning agents penetrate the hair shaft, impacting hydration and manageability. For instance, a product label might specify a period of three to five minutes for optimal results, allowing sufficient time for absorption without causing build-up.
Appropriate application duration maximizes the potential benefits of conditioning treatments. Adequate dwell time enhances the deposition of moisturizing and strengthening ingredients, leading to improved hair texture, reduced frizz, and increased shine. Historically, prolonged exposure was believed to provide superior results; however, modern formulations are designed to work effectively within shorter, specified time frames.
